I have data (see attached) that I update every week. I have to track 20 regions of data and 5 different discrepancies.

I want to create a dynamic pivot table that I can update every week with the new data. Then I have to create charts as well.

The problem I'm having is that I don't just chart the entire 20 regions. I'll need a total of 25 charts. First chart would be region 2, 4, 10, 12 & 20 for discrepancy 1, then region 2, 4, 10, 12 & 20 for discrepancy 2 and so on to discrepancy 5. Then I choose 5 more regions, (example) 1, 5, 9, 17 & 19 for discrepancy 1 and so on to discrepancy 5. What is the best way to set this up?
